Випуск ядра Linux 6.18: нові можливості та поліпшення
Випуск ядра Linux 6.18: нові можливості та поліпшення
Ядро Linux 6.18 тепер доступне для завантаження, про що сьогодні оголосив сам Лінус Торвальдс. Нове ядро пропонує розширену підтримку апаратного забезпечення завдяки новим та оновленим драйверам, поліпшенням файлових систем і мережевих технологій, а також багато іншого.
Основні особливості Linux 6.18
Серед особливостей Linux 6.18 варто відзначити видалення файлової системи Bcachefs, підтримку драйвера Rust Binder, новий цільовий мапер dm-pcache, що дозволяє використовувати постійну пам’ять як кеш для повільніших блочних пристроїв, а також нову опцію командного рядка microcode= для контролю поведінки завантажувача мікрокоду на платформах x86.
Покращення у файлових системах та мережі
Ядро Linux 6.18 також розширює підтримку файлових дескрипторів для простору імен ядра, впроваджує початкову підтримку ‘block size > page size’ для файлової системи Btrfs і додає виявлення функцій PTW на новому апаратному забезпеченні для LoongArch KVM.
Додатково, нові можливості включають підтримку шифрування PSP для TCP-з’єднань, підтримку змішаних розмірів подій черги завершення (CQE) у одному кільцевому буфері та підтримку роботи ядра як гостя на гіпервізорі Bhyve FreeBSD.
Нові драйвери та поліпшення продуктивності
Ядро Linux 6.18 також покращує продуктивність підкачки, посилює масштабування серверів NFS, поліпшує продуктивність прийому UDP і впроваджує нову функцію «sheaves» для покращення продуктивності виділення пам’яті ядра. Під час цього також реалізовано підтримку рідкісних переривань для User-mode-Linux (UML).
Файлова система EXT4 та безпека
Файлова система EXT4 отримала підтримку 32-бітних резервних ідентифікаторів користувачів та груп, а TCP стек — первинну підтримку Accurate Explicit Congestion Notification (AccECN). Крім того, OverlayFS тепер підтримує регістри з урахуванням регістру.
Серед інших важливих змін, ядро Linux 6.18 покращує Kernel-based Virtual Machine (KVM) для підтримки технології примусової обробки контролю потоку (CET), додає підтримку SEV-SNP CipherText Hiding на хостах x86, а також підтримку збереження vmalloc-алокацій до Kexec HandOver (KHO).
Доступність та майбутні релізи
Ви можете завантажити ядро Linux 6.18 вже зараз з kernel.org або з git-репозиторію Лінуса Торвальдса, якщо ви хочете скомпілювати його для вашого дистрибутиву GNU/Linux. Я рекомендую дочекатися, поки новий реліз з’явиться у стабільних репозиторіях вашого дистрибутиву перед оновленням ядра.
Тепер, коли ядро Linux 6.18 випущено, відкривається вікно злиття для наступної великої гілки ядра, Linux 6.19, який очікується на початку лютого 2026 року. Перший кандидат на реліз Linux 6.19 буде доступний для публічного тестування 14 грудня.
Оскільки Linux 6.18 є останнім релізом ядра цього року, він може стати наступним ядром LTS (Long-Term Support), яке підтримуватиметься принаймні кілька років. Однак, нам потрібно дочекатися підтвердження статусу LTS для Linux 6.18 від відомого розробника ядра Грега Кроа-Хартмана, тож слідкуйте за новинами!




